PTI Finalizes Opposition Leaders: Mahmood Khan Achakzai for National Assembly, Raja Nasir Abbas for Senate

Islamabad: Following directives from party founder **Imran Khan** and the removal of legal hurdles by the **Peshawar High Court**, the **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I)** has finalized the names for **Opposition Leaders** in both the **National Assembly** and the **Senate**.
According to party sources, the **PTI Parliamentary Committee** has unanimously approved **Mehmood Khan Achakzai**, chief of the **Pashtoonkhwa Milli Awami Party (PkMAP)**, as Leader of the Opposition in the **National Assembly**, and **Allama Raja Nasir Abbas**, head of the **Majlis Wahdat-e-Muslimeen (MWM)**, as Opposition Leader in the **Senate**.
Both names will be formally submitted to the **National Assembly Secretariat** and **Senate Secretariat** tomorrow (Tuesday).
This development follows the **Peshawar High Court’s decision** to withdraw a stay order related to the disqualification of former opposition leaders **Umar Ayub** and **Shibli Faraz**, who had been de-notified by the **Election Commission** after convictions in the **May 9 cases**. Their removal had left both opposition leader positions vacant.
The final approval for the new appointments was given by **Imran Khan** from **Adiala Jail**, after which the parliamentary body ratified the decision.
**Mahmood Khan Achakzai** currently heads the opposition alliance **Tehreek Tahafuz-e-Aeen-e-Pakistan**, while **Allama Raja Nasir Abbas’s MWM** is also a key partner in the same coalition — signaling PTI’s strategic intent to strengthen coordination among opposition parties within Parliament.
